I was wondering i know that Video in motion is not allowed but does it cut off the sound completely aswel?I mean would it not be possible to play a music video and retract the screen and have the music still play.I ask because I have a collection of my fav songs as music videos and its going to be a tedious process to rip the audio from all of them

Thanks
 
I think it still plays the audio, but not sure
 
it does still play audio while showing the msg "video playback not available while in motion" or something like that. as soon as you stop for example in a traffic light and hill hold assist turns on video is resumed once again till you start moving again.
